Managing Staff Scheduling in Fitness Environments
Effective staff scheduling is particularly challenging in the fitness industry, where variable class attendance, specialized instructor certifications, and part-time employment arrangements create complex scheduling scenarios. For Baltimore gym owners, implementing structured approaches to staff scheduling can dramatically improve operational efficiency and staff satisfaction.
- Skill-Based Scheduling: Matching staff skills to specific class requirements ensures qualified instructors lead appropriate sessions while creating development opportunities for staff looking to expand their teaching repertoire.
- Availability Management: Digital systems that track staff availability preferences and constraints prevent scheduling conflicts and reduce last-minute changes that disrupt operations.
- Shift Trading Platforms: Implementing a shift marketplace where instructors can exchange classes (within management-approved parameters) provides flexibility while maintaining coverage requirements.
- Fatigue Management: Particularly for high-intensity class instructors, scheduling systems should help prevent burnout by ensuring adequate rest between classes and limiting consecutive high-exertion sessions.
- Performance-Based Scheduling: Allocating prime time slots to instructors who consistently attract and retain members incentivizes performance and maximizes class attendance.
Scheduling staff effectively requires balancing business needs with employee preferences and wellbeing. By implementing systems that address these sometimes competing priorities, Baltimore gym owners can create stable, predictable schedules that benefit both the business and its team members.

Compliance with Maryland Labor Laws in Scheduling
Scheduling practices must comply with relevant labor laws to avoid legal complications and ensure fair treatment of employees. Maryland has specific labor regulations that affect how Baltimore gyms schedule their staff, and scheduling systems should help facilitate compliance rather than create additional legal risks.
- Overtime Calculation: Maryland follows federal guidelines requiring overtime pay for hours worked beyond 40 in a workweek, and scheduling systems should track weekly hours and flag potential overtime situations.
- Break Requirements: While Maryland doesn’t mandate meal or rest breaks for adult employees, scheduling software that incorporates breaks into shift patterns helps maintain staff wellbeing and performance.
- Minor Employment Restrictions: For gyms employing workers under 18 (common for reception or cleaning roles), scheduling must comply with stricter hour limitations and time-of-day restrictions for minors.
- Record Keeping Requirements: Maryland requires employers to maintain accurate records of hours worked, and digital scheduling systems create audit trails that satisfy these requirements.
- Sick Leave Compliance: Maryland’s Healthy Working Families Act requires employers to provide earned sick leave, and scheduling systems should track accruals and usage to ensure compliance.

3. What Maryland-specific regulations affect gym staff scheduling?
Maryland follows federal overtime laws requiring payment for hours worked beyond 40 in a workweek. The state’s Healthy Working Families Act mandates earned sick leave accrual (1 hour for every 30 hours worked) for most employees. For staff under 18, Maryland has strict hour limitations and time-of-day restrictions. Baltimore City’s specific ordinances may also affect scheduling practices, particularly regarding minimum wage requirements. While Maryland doesn’t currently have predictive scheduling laws (unlike some states), maintaining consistent schedules is still considered a best practice for employee satisfaction. Good scheduling software helps track these requirements and alerts managers to potential compliance issues.
4. How can I transition from manual to digital scheduling systems?
Transitioning from manual to digital scheduling requires careful planning and change management. Start by documenting your current scheduling processes and identifying pain points and objectives for the new system. Research and select a solution that addresses your specific needs, preferably with experience serving Baltimore fitness businesses. Before implementation, clean and organize your existing data. Consider a phased approach—perhaps beginning with staff scheduling before adding member-facing features. Provide comprehensive training for all user groups and designate internal champions who can support others. Run parallel systems temporarily during the transition, and collect regular feedback to address issues quickly. Most gyms can complete a full transition within 4-8 weeks.
